Location

The venue is situated within the centre of the town.

This venue is situated in Littlehampton.

The venue is not on a road with a steep gradient.

The nearest mainline Railway Station is Littlehampton.

There is a bus stop within 150m (164yds) of the venue.

Parking

Parking Image

This venue does not have its own car park.

There is a car park for public use within 200m (approx).

The name of the car park is Manor House.

The car park is located off Beach Road.

On street marked Blue Badge bays are not available.

Clearly signed and/or standard on street marked bays are available.

Standard marked parking bays are located off Beach Road.

There is not a designated drop off point.

Outside Access (Main Entrance)

Outside Access Image

This information is for the entrance located to the front of the building.

There is level access to the service.

The main doors open automatically.

The doors are single width.

The door opening is 92cm (3ft ) wide.

The automatic door is by a push pad

Reception

Reception Image

The reception desk is 4m (13ft 1in) from the main entrance.

There is level access to reception from the entrance.

The reception desk is low.

Lighting levels are medium.

There is a hearing assistance system.

The hearing system is a portable loop.

Staff are trained to use the hearing system.

Inside Access

Inside Access Image

There is level access to the service.

There is a hearing assistance system.

The system is a portable loop.

Staff are trained to use the hearing assistance system.

The lighting levels are medium.

Motorised scooters are not allowed in public parts of the venue.

Other Floors

Other Floors Image

The floors which are accessible by stairs are G-1-2.

There are 15+ steps between floors.

The lighting level is medium.

The steps are clearly marked.

The steps are medium height.

The steps do have handrails.

The steps have a handrail on the left side going up.

There is a landing.

The services on the floors which are not accessible are additional classrooms and standard toilets.

Adapted Toilet

AdaptedToilet Image

There are adapted toilets within this venue designated for public use.

Location of and access to adapted toilets

The toilet is not for the sole use of disabled people.

There is pictorial signage on or near the toilet door.

The adapted toilet is 10m (11yd) from the main entrance.

The adapted toilet is located to the right as you enter.

There is level access to the adapted toilet.

Features and dimensions of adapted toilets

This is a unisex toilet.

A key is not required for the adapted toilet.

The door opens outwards.

The door is locked by a twist lock.

The width of the adapted toilet door is 85cm (2ft 9in).

The door is heavy.

The dimensions of the adapted toilet are 150cm x 210cm (4ft 11in x 6ft 10in).

Floor manoeuvring space is clear in the adapted toilet.

There is a lateral transfer space.

As you face the toilet pan the transfer space is on the left.

The lateral transfer space is 85cm (2ft 9in).

There is a dropdown rail on the transfer side.

There is a flush on the transfer side.

The tap type is lever.

There is a mixer tap.

There is a functional emergency alarm available.

Disposal facilities are available in the cubicle.

There is not a coat hook.

Position of fixtures in adapted toilets

Wall mounted rails are available.

As you face the toilet the wall mounted grab rails are on both sides.

There is not a shelf within the adapted toilet.

There are mirrors in the adapted toilet.

Mirrors are not placed at a lower level or at an angle for ease of use.

The height of the toilet seat above floor level is 47cm (1ft 6in).

There is a towel dispenser.

The towel dispenser cannot be reached from seated on the toilet.

The towel dispenser is placed higher than 100cm.

The towel dispenser is 133cm (4ft 4in) high.

There is a toilet roll holder.

The toilet roll holder can be reached from seated on the toilet.

The toilet roll holder is not placed higher than 100cm.

There is a sink.

The sink cannot be reached from seated on the toilet.

The sink is not placed higher than 74cm.

Colour contrast and lighting in adapted toilets

The contrast between the internal door and wall is good.

The contrast between the external door and wall is good.

The contrast between the grab rails and wall is good.

The contrast between the drop down rails and wall is good.

The contrast between the walls and floor is good.

Lighting levels are medium.

The adapted toilet also severs as a unisex standard toilet.

Standard Toilet

Availability and Location of Standard Toilets

Standard toilets are available.

Access to Standard Female and Male Toilets

The female and male toilets are located on the second floor.

The female and male toilets are 35m (38yd) from the main entrance.

Inside the venue, there is level access to the female and male toilet.

Lighting levels are medium.

Additional Information

Staff do receive disability awareness training.

Documents can be requested in Braille.

Documents are available in large print.

Registered assistance dogs are welcomed.

A member of staff trained in BSL skills is not generally on duty.

This service can be requested.

Staff are not Text Relay aware.
